You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@daffodil.apache.org by ar...@apache.org on 2023/09/27 17:23:43 UTC
[daffodil-vscode] branch main updated: Update fs2-io to 3.9.1
This is an automated email from the ASF dual-hosted git repository.
arosien pushed a commit to branch main
in repository https://gitbox.apache.org/repos/asf/daffodil-vscode.git
The following commit(s) were added to refs/heads/main by this push:
new 2f70023 Update fs2-io to 3.9.1
2f70023 is described below
commit 2f7002394ffc6e3e85a609c72f2e0bce17cfec70
Author: github-actions[bot] <41...@users.noreply.github.com>
AuthorDate: Fri Sep 1 00:21:45 2023 +0000
Update fs2-io to 3.9.1
Fix use of deprecated methods.
---
build.sbt | 2 +-
debugger/src/main/scala/org.apache.daffodil.debugger.dap/DAPodil.scala | 2 +-
debugger/src/main/scala/org.apache.daffodil.debugger.dap/Parse.scala | 2 +-
3 files changed, 3 insertions(+), 3 deletions(-)
diff --git a/build.sbt b/build.sbt
index 0df9a8a..3ca33cb 100644
--- a/build.sbt
+++ b/build.sbt
@@ -98,7 +98,7 @@ lazy val debugger = project
"ch.qos.logback" % "logback-classic" % "1.2.11",
"com.microsoft.java" % "com.microsoft.java.debug.core" % "0.34.0",
// scala-steward:on
- "co.fs2" %% "fs2-io" % "3.2.14",
+ "co.fs2" %% "fs2-io" % "3.9.1",
"com.monovore" %% "decline-effect" % "2.3.1",
"org.typelevel" %% "log4cats-slf4j" % "2.5.0",
"org.scalameta" %% "munit" % "0.7.29" % Test
diff --git a/debugger/src/main/scala/org.apache.daffodil.debugger.dap/DAPodil.scala b/debugger/src/main/scala/org.apache.daffodil.debugger.dap/DAPodil.scala
index b344e72..9acfa1c 100644
--- a/debugger/src/main/scala/org.apache.daffodil.debugger.dap/DAPodil.scala
+++ b/debugger/src/main/scala/org.apache.daffodil.debugger.dap/DAPodil.scala
@@ -81,7 +81,7 @@ object DAPSession {
def resource(socket: Socket): Resource[IO, DAPSession[Request, Response, DebugEvent]] =
for {
- dispatcher <- Dispatcher[IO]
+ dispatcher <- Dispatcher.parallel[IO]
requests <- Resource.eval(Queue.bounded[IO, Option[Request]](10))
server <- Server.resource(socket.getInputStream, socket.getOutputStream, dispatcher, requests)
session = DAPSession(server, Stream.fromQueueNoneTerminated(requests))
diff --git a/debugger/src/main/scala/org.apache.daffodil.debugger.dap/Parse.scala b/debugger/src/main/scala/org.apache.daffodil.debugger.dap/Parse.scala
index 26c58f7..12aed20 100644
--- a/debugger/src/main/scala/org.apache.daffodil.debugger.dap/Parse.scala
+++ b/debugger/src/main/scala/org.apache.daffodil.debugger.dap/Parse.scala
@@ -1329,7 +1329,7 @@ object Parse {
infosetFormat: String
): Resource[IO, DaffodilDebugger] =
for {
- dispatcher <- Dispatcher[IO]
+ dispatcher <- Dispatcher.parallel[IO]
} yield new DaffodilDebugger(
dispatcher,
state,